Bank liquid assets as a share of short-term liabilities fell 3.55% to 289% in Moldova in 2023, according to the National Central Bank.
Historically, bank liquid assets as a share of short-term liabilities in Moldova reached an all time high of 300% in 2022 and an all time low of 42.3% in 2014.
Moldova has been ranked 1st within the group of 68 countries we follow in terms of bank liquid assets as a share of short-term liabilities, 30 places above the position seen 10 years ago.
